Programming with Implicit Flows

被引:10
|
作者
Salvaneschi, Guido [1 ]
Mezini, Mira [1 ,2 ]
Eugster, Patrick [1 ,3 ]
机构
[1] Tech Univ Darmstadt, Darmstadt, Germany
[2] Univ Lancaster, Lancaster LA1 4YW, England
[3] Purdue Univ, W Lafayette, IN 47907 USA
基金
欧洲研究理事会;
关键词
LANGUAGE;
D O I
10.1109/MS.2014.101
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Modern software differs significantly from traditional computer applications that mostly process reasonably small amounts of static input data-sets in batch mode. Modern software increasingly processes massive amounts of data, whereby it is also often the case that new input data is produced and/or existing data is modified on the fly. Consequently, programming models that facilitate the development of such software are emerging. What characterizes them is that data, respectively changes thereof, implicitly flow through computation modules. The software engineer declaratively defines computations as compositions of other computations without explicitly modeling how data should flow along dependency relations between data producer and data consumer modules, letting the runtime to automatically manage and optimize data flows. © 2014 IEEE.
引用
收藏
页码:52 / 59
页数:8
相关论文
共 50 条
  • [1] Static Information Flow Analysis with Handling of Implicit Flows and A Study on Effects of Implicit Flows vs Explicit Flows
    Liu, Yin
    Milanova, Ana
    14TH EUROPEAN CONFERENCE ON SOFTWARE MAINTENANCE AND REENGINEERING (CSMR 2010), 2010, : 146 - 155
  • [2] Implicit Parameters for Logic Programming
    Madsen, Magnus
    Lhotak, Ondrej
    PPDP'18: PROCEEDINGS OF THE 20TH INTERNATIONAL SYMPOSIUM ON PRINCIPLES AND PRACTICE OF DECLARATIVE PROGRAMMING, 2018,
  • [3] Implicit Differential Dynamic Programming
    Jallet, Wilson
    Mansard, Nicolas
    Carpentier, Justin
    2022 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ION (ICRA 2022), 2022, : 1455 - 1461
  • [4] IMPLICIT MULTIGRID TECHNIQUES FOR COMPRESSIBLE FLOWS
    CAUGHEY, DA
    COMPUTERS & FLUIDS, 1993, 22 (2-3) : 117 - 124
  • [5] Implicit methods for viscous incompressible flows
    Kwak, Dochan
    Kiris, Cetin
    Housman, Jeffrey
    COMPUTERS & FLUIDS, 2011, 41 (01) : 51 - 64
  • [6] An implicit potential method for incompressible flows
    Papadopoulos, P. K.
    INTERNATIONAL JOURNAL FOR NUMERICAL METHODS IN ENGINEERING, 2013, 94 (07) : 672 - 686
  • [7] IMPLICIT NUMERICAL MODELING OF UNSTEADY FLOWS
    FRANZ, DD
    JOURNAL OF THE HYDRAULICS DIVISION-ASCE, 1976, 102 (01): : 122 - 124
  • [8] IMPLICIT NUMERICAL MODELING OF UNSTEADY FLOWS
    AMEIN, M
    CHU, HL
    JOURNAL OF THE HYDRAULICS DIVISION-ASCE, 1975, 101 (NHY6): : 717 - 731
  • [9] Linear programming fitting of implicit polynomials
    Lei, ZB
    Cooper, DB
    I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 1998, 20 (02) : 212 - 217
  • [10] IMPLICIT NUMERICAL MODELING OF UNSTEADY FLOWS
    AMEIN, M
    CHU, HL
    JOURNAL OF THE HYDRAULICS DIVISION-ASCE, 1976, 102 (09): : 1399 - 1399